Changing Battery
You must change the battery immediately and reset the date and time when the
battery power is extremely low and “ & ” appears on the screen. The
meter cannot be turned on.
To change the battery, do the following:
1. Press the edge of the battery cover and lift it up to remove the cover.
2. Remove the old battery and replace with one 1.5V AAA size alkaline battery.
3. Close the battery cover. If the battery is inserted correctly, you will hear a
“beep” afterwards.
CAUTION
RISK OF EXPLOSION IF BATTERY IS REPLACED BY AN
INCORRECT TYPE.
DISPOSE OF USED BATTERIES ACCORDING TO THE
INSTRUCTIONS.
